public class TransportNodesSnapshotsStatus extends TransportNodesAction<TransportNodesSnapshotsStatus.Request,TransportNodesSnapshotsStatus.NodesSnapshotStatus,TransportNodesSnapshotsStatus.NodeRequest,TransportNodesSnapshotsStatus.NodeSnapshotStatus>
| Modifier and Type | Class | Description |
|---|---|---|
static class |
TransportNodesSnapshotsStatus.NodeRequest |
|
static class |
TransportNodesSnapshotsStatus.NodeSnapshotStatus |
|
static class |
TransportNodesSnapshotsStatus.NodesSnapshotStatus |
|
static class |
TransportNodesSnapshotsStatus.Request |
| Modifier and Type | Field | Description |
|---|---|---|
static java.lang.String |
ACTION_NAME |
deprecationLogger, logger, settingsactionName, indexNameExpressionResolver, taskManager, threadPoolclusterService, nodeResponseClass, transportService| Constructor | Description |
|---|---|
TransportNodesSnapshotsStatus(Settings settings,
ThreadPool threadPool,
ClusterService clusterService,
TransportService transportService,
SnapshotShardsService snapshotShardsService,
ActionFilters actionFilters,
IndexNameExpressionResolver indexNameExpressionResolver) |
| Modifier and Type | Method | Description |
|---|---|---|
protected TransportNodesSnapshotsStatus.NodeRequest |
newNodeRequest(java.lang.String nodeId,
TransportNodesSnapshotsStatus.Request request) |
|
protected TransportNodesSnapshotsStatus.NodeSnapshotStatus |
newNodeResponse() |
|
protected TransportNodesSnapshotsStatus.NodesSnapshotStatus |
newResponse(TransportNodesSnapshotsStatus.Request request,
java.util.List<TransportNodesSnapshotsStatus.NodeSnapshotStatus> responses,
java.util.List<FailedNodeException> failures) |
Create a new
TransportNodesAction (multi-node response). |
protected TransportNodesSnapshotsStatus.NodeSnapshotStatus |
nodeOperation(TransportNodesSnapshotsStatus.NodeRequest request) |
|
protected boolean |
transportCompress() |
logDeprecatedSetting, logRemovedSetting, nodeNameclone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itexecute, execute, execute, executedoExecute, doExecute, newResponse, nodeOperation, resolveRequestpublic static final java.lang.String ACTION_NAME
@Inject public TransportNodesSnapshotsStatus(Settings settings, ThreadPool threadPool, ClusterService clusterService, TransportService transportService, SnapshotShardsService snapshotShardsService, ActionFilters actionFilters, IndexNameExpressionResolver indexNameExpressionResolver)
protected boolean transportCompress()
protected TransportNodesSnapshotsStatus.NodeRequest newNodeRequest(java.lang.String nodeId, TransportNodesSnapshotsStatus.Request request)
protected TransportNodesSnapshotsStatus.NodeSnapshotStatus newNodeResponse()
protected TransportNodesSnapshotsStatus.NodesSnapshotStatus newResponse(TransportNodesSnapshotsStatus.Request request, java.util.List<TransportNodesSnapshotsStatus.NodeSnapshotStatus> responses, java.util.List<FailedNodeException> failures)
TransportNodesActionTransportNodesAction (multi-node response).newResponse in class TransportNodesAction<TransportNodesSnapshotsStatus.Request,TransportNodesSnapshotsStatus.NodesSnapshotStatus,TransportNodesSnapshotsStatus.NodeRequest,TransportNodesSnapshotsStatus.NodeSnapshotStatus>request - The associated request.responses - All successful node-level responses.failures - All node-level failures.null.protected TransportNodesSnapshotsStatus.NodeSnapshotStatus nodeOperation(TransportNodesSnapshotsStatus.NodeRequest request)